A restraining order was issued two months ago to a person identified as a Tennessee House GOP research analyst accused of using the Internet to allegedly defame state Rep. Nathan Vaughn of Kingsport, the Times-News has learned....
The Web content, according to the court filings, did not identify the persons who paid for and authorized the sites.
Gilmer, identified as the research analyst, was also identified as an aide to House GOP Caucus Chairman Glen Casada of Franklin.
Neither Mumpower nor Gilmer immediately responded to e-mails and phone calls seeking comment.
